Chocolate Banana Frozen Yogurt

A creamy and indulgent frozen treat made with ripe bananas and Greek yogurt, blended with cocoa for a chocolatey flavor that's quick to prepare and naturally sweet.

Ingredients
  

For the Frozen Yogurt

  • 2 pieces ripe bananas Look for brown-speckled skin for best sweetness and creaminess.
  • 2 cups Greek yogurt Plain, full-fat or 2% for the creamiest mouthfeel.
  • 1/4 cup unsweetened cocoa powder Dutch-processed will give a rounder, less acidic chocolate note.
  • 1/4 cup honey Or to taste; maple syrup or agave are good vegan swaps.
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ract Enhances the chocolate and banana flavors.
  • 1 pinch salt Balances sweetness and deepens flavor.

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Slice the ripe bananas into 1/2-inch rounds and freeze on a single layer for about 2 hours, or until solid.
  • Add the frozen banana slices to a high-speed blender or food processor. Add the Greek yogurt, cocoa powder, honey, vanilla extract, and a pinch of salt.
  • Pulse to break up the bananas, then blend continuously until the mixture turns smooth and creamy. Scrape down the sides as needed.
  • If the mixture gets stuck, add 1–2 tablespoons of milk (dairy or plant-based) to help it move.
  • Taste and adjust sweetness with more honey, maple, or powdered sugar if desired.
  • Serve immediately for a soft-serve consistency, or transfer to an airtight container and freeze for 1–3 hours for firmer scoops.
  • If frozen solid, let it sit 5–10 minutes at room temperature before scooping.

Notes

Best served slightly softened. Top with toasted chopped nuts, fresh banana slices, berries, a drizzle of nut butter, or granola. Store in an airtight, freezer-safe container for up to 2 weeks.
